Vanguard Intermediate-Term Bond ETF Surpasses 200-Day Moving Average

In trading on Thursday, shares of the Vanguard Intermediate-Term Bond ETF (Symbol: BIV) exceeded their 200-day moving average of $76.22, reaching a peak of $76.25. The ETF is currently up approximately 0.3% for the day.

The chart illustrates BIV’s performance over the past year against its 200-day moving average. BIV’s 52-week low stands at $73.72, while the 52-week high is $78.89, juxtaposed with the last trade at $76.19.
